Will the vehicle start and run? If it cranks good but won't start, have a helper crank it, while you visuall check for spark at the plugs. If you have spark everywhere, use a gage and check fuel pressure. Can you check applicable trouble codes? I hate to see you throw parts at it. Usually the computer has to see both the cam and crank sensor signal or it won't ground the asd relay. The asd relay supplies voltage to several circuits.
